NVIDIA Quadro M600M vs NVIDIA Tesla M2070

We compared two Professional market GPUs: 2GB VRAM Quadro M600M and 6GB VRAM Tesla M2070 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A Quadro M600M 's Advantages
Released 4 years and 1 months late
Boost Clock876MHz
Lower TDP (30W vs 225W)
NVIDIA Tesla M2070 's Advantages
More VRAM (6GB vs 2GB)
Larger VRAM bandwidth (150.3GB/s vs 80.19GB/s)
64 additional rendering cores
